#6D223D Color
#6D223D is rgb(109, 34, 61) in RGB, hsl(338, 52%, 28%) in HSL, and about cmyk(0%, 69%, 44%, 57%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Old Mauve (#673147),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 9.77. White text is the more readable choice on this background.

#6D223D Channel Values
How #6D223D bre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 109 · G 34 · B 61 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 338° · S 52% · L 28%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 338° · S 69% · V 43%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 0% · M 69% · Y 44% · K 57%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 10.79:1 vs white · 1.95: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#6D223D background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#6D223D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#6D223D?
#6D223D is a dark pink — rgb(109, 34, 61) in RGB and hsl(338, 52%, 28%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Old Mauve (#673147),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 9.77.
What is the RGB value of #6D223D?
#6D223D is rgb(109, 34, 61) — red 109, green 34, and blue 61 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#6D223D?
#6D223D converts to approximately cmyk(0%, 69%, 44%, 57%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#6D223D be black or white?
White text is the more readable choice. #6D223D scores 10.79:1 against white and 1.95: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#6D223D as a CSS color keyword?
No. #6D223D is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is brown (#A52A2A) at a CIE76 distance of 35.57, which is a different colour altogether.
